Road cycling routes around Chalain-Le-Comtal traverse the tranquil agricultural landscape of the Plaine du Forez in France's Loire department. The area offers accessible paths, including renovated sections along the Loire River, and benefits from its rural setting. While the immediate vicinity is characterized by flat to gently rolling terrain, the region is within reasonable distance of the more varied landscapes of Pilat Regional Natural Park and Livradois-Forez Regional Natural Park.

Montrond-les-Bains is particularly known for its medieval castle and its thermal baths, which attract many visitors looking for well-being and relaxation. In addition to its historical and thermal heritage, Montrond-les-Bains offers a dynamic cultural life with various festivals and events throughout the year. The city is crossed by a magnificent greenway which will delight cyclists!

Montbrison, the historic capital of Forez, is rich in heritage sites not to be missed. The town center of Montbrison with its shopping streets and alleys, its lively terraces, is a lively and friendly place.
4
0
The Notre-Dame-d'Espérance Collegiate Church is the largest Gothic church in the Loire department. The construction of this Gothic church spanned almost two centuries (1223-1466). With its beautiful architecture, it is the heart of the city and one of the most beautiful churches in the whole region.

There are over 280 road cycling routes around Chalain-Le-Comtal, catering to various skill levels. This includes 48 easy routes, 176 moderate routes, and 59 difficult routes, offering a wide range of options for exploration.
The terrain around Chalain-Le-Comtal is primarily characterized by the tranquil agricultural landscape of the Plaine du Forez, offering mostly flat to gently rolling paths. You'll find renovated sections along the Loire River and greenways, particularly near Montrond-les-Bains. Some routes may include more varied terrain and climbs as you venture closer to the regional natural parks.
Yes, the region offers several easy routes suitable for families. The agricultural plains and renovated paths along the Loire River provide accessible and relatively flat terrain. For instance, the Saint-Laurent-la-Conche and Ponds of Feurs Loop is an easy option that offers pleasant views of local ponds and agricultural land.
For scenic rides, consider routes that explore the Loire River banks or offer panoramic views. The Hurongues Pond – Panoramic View loop from Montrond-les-Bains is a popular choice, leading through varied terrain with expansive vistas. The renovated 'chemin des bords de Loire' also provides picturesque cycling opportunities.
Yes, for advanced cyclists seeking more challenging rides, there are 59 difficult routes in the area. These routes often feature greater elevation changes as they venture towards the more varied landscapes surrounding the Plaine du Forez. An example of a challenging route is the Hill climb alongside the Loire – Loire Bridge loop from Montrond-les-Bains, which includes significant climbs.
While cycling, you can encounter various points of interest. Near Chalain-Le-Comtal, you might pass by the 19th-century Château de Sourcieux or Château de la Pommière, or the Église Saint-Ennemond. Further afield, the town of Montrond-les-Bains offers its medieval castle and thermal baths. Other notable historical sites include Montverdun Priory and Champdieu Priory.
Yes, many of the road cycling routes around Chalain-Le-Comtal are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end in the same location. Popular circular routes include the The curist trail – Montrond-les-Bains loop from Montrond-les-Bains, which explores the area's greenways and castle.

Yes, the region, particularly around Montrond-les-Bains, is known for its greenways and dedicated cycling paths. The commune has also renovated sections of the 'chemin des bords de Loire,' which is part of a larger project for a GR3 route along the Loire River, providing excellent options for cyclists. The Greenway – Montrond-les-Bains loop from Montrond-les-Bains is a great example of a route utilizing these paths.
The spring and summer months are generally ideal for road biking in Chalain-Le-Comtal. The agricultural landscape is vibrant, and the weather is typically pleasant for outdoor activities. The renovated paths along the Loire River and the greenways are particularly enjoyable during these seasons.
